The Zutons To Release New Single

added 04 November 2004 at 10.53

While the band's recent sell-out tour was cut short due to illness in the group, The Zutons have confirmed the release of a new single and rearranged their recently cancelled tour dates, as promised.

The Zutons have confirmed yet another single release from their Mercury nominated 'Who Killed The Zutons?' record. The band will release 'Confusion' next month through Deltasonic.

The single will hit shops on December 13 and is currently featured on a Peugeot television advert.

B-sides will include a session version of 'Jump Sturdy' (recently selected as the theme for the new Levi's ad campaign in America) and the original version of 'You Will, You Won't'.

Following the cancellation of the remainder of their UK tour, the band have rearranged the dates following the recovery of drummer Sean Payne from a severe viral infection. Payne fell last month forcing the band to scrap stheir London’s Shepherds Bush Empire, Derry, Belfast and Dublin shows.

The band recently told Xfm that they hope to begin work on their second album in the very near future.

“We’re playing a new song ‘Weekend Scrub’ in the set,” saxophonist Abi Harding revealed. “It might be on the next album or it might not. We’ve got lots of other ideas as well, but we just need some time to finish the writing before we go in and start recording.

‘Weekend Scrub’ is just one of those songs about trying too hard too hard to pull. It’s a bit more groove-based and just more dynamic like some of the later songs that we’ve done like ‘Dirty Dancehall’ and ‘Pressure Point’."

The Zutons release 'Confusion' on Decmber 13 while the re-released album ‘Who Killed The Zutons?’ featuring recent single 'Don't Ever Think (Too Much) is out now.

The band’s rearranged tour dates are as follows. Tickets from the cancelled October tour will be valid for these dates.

  • Dublin Ambassador (December 11)
  • Derry Nerve Centre (12)
  • Belfast Spring And Airbrake (13)
  • London Shepherds Bush Empire (15)
  • Liverpool Royal Court (17, 18)
  • Cambridge Junction (21)
